November 30, 2017 Opinion or Order MINUTE ORDER granting #9 , #10 Motions for Extension of Time, MINUTE ORDER re Plaintiffs' temporary restraining order, and MINUTE ENTRY for status conference held before Judge Carol Bagley Amon on November 30, 2017. Appearances: Plaintiffs - Nicolas Fortuna, Paula Lopez; Defendants - Padmaja Chinta, Antoaneta Tarpanova. As stated on the record, the parties must file new cross-motions for a preliminary injunction if they plan on seeking such relief. Plaintiffs represent that they plan to seek a preliminary injunction based on their unfair competition claims under New York law, and Defendants represent that they plan to seek a preliminary injunction based at least on their trademark infringement claims under the federal Lanham Act. Pursuant to Rule 65(b)(2) of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ure, and because all parties consent, the Court extends the November 1, 2017, temporary restraining order ("TRO") issued by the Honorable Sylvia G. Ash, Justice of the Supreme Court of New York, Kings County, in favor of Plaintiffs, (D.E. # 1-61 at 2-3; D.E. # 10-5 at 2-3). The TRO remains in effect until the disposition of the case or of the parties' new cross-motions for preliminary injunction, whichever occurs earlier.
